AL: BNP's quitting poll preplanned

Trashing the allegations of vote manipulation, Awami League Joint General Secretary Mahbubul Alam Hanif has said the BNP's announcement of quitting the polls was preplanned.

He made the remarks while expressing his party's reaction over BNP's announcement of rejecting the polls in both the city corporations under Dhaka at a press briefing on Tuesday afternoon.

Claiming the BNP is trying to create a new issue for conducting nationwide violence, he said: “The BNP has boycotted the polls as it understood it would lose the race. It was preplanned.”

“The BNP leaders do not want peace. They are looking for a new issue to affect the ongoing peaceful situation in the country.”
